There are a lot of things that can happen when you travel. Normally, the problems happen because the travelers were unprepared. If you want to avoid the problems that come along with poor vacation planning, read on for some great advice.

Don’t bring any unnecessary valuables with you. The more items you have with you, the chance will be higher that you will leave one behind, or an item gets stolen.

Planning ahead is important for any trip, but especially important if you are traveling by air. Many airports are located in major cities, and reaching them in congested traffic can be difficult and time consuming. Pack what you can the night before your flight so you are sure to be ready to leave the next day. To reduce your pre-flight anxiety, prepare for your trip well in advance. One of the worst ways to start a trip is to miss your flight.

When you are traveling in unfamiliar locations, be sure to watch for scammers posing as government officials trying to take advantage of you. Never give someone your passport, because they might not give it back to you. If you are asked to go to an office with them, walk. Do not get into a vehicle with someone that you do not know.

Whenever you can, print online tickets in advance of your visit to a special event or attraction. Just avoiding the time you will wait in line makes up for the small online printing fee. If your destination offers timed entry, printed tickets can also be used to get around the admission line.

When you travel try your best to educate your family as much as you can along the way. If you take reasonable precautions, there is no reason to fear travel to the developing world. It can be a great chance to show your children how the world outside of your country works. Spending time abroad is a great way to build an understanding of, and tolerance for, other cultures.

Try taking a mild sleeping aid during your red-eye flight. Some people have a lot of trouble sleeping on planes due to the unfamiliar people, uncomfortable seating, and noise level. To help you get some sleep during your flight, you should take a pill that makes you relax. Don’t take the medication before you go in case there are delays or problems with the plane.

As stated above, many people have vacation horror stories because they did not properly prepare for their trip. The advice from this article will help you plan a safe, relaxing vacation.
